Bear Creek is an outstanding trail located
in the Chattahoochee
National Forest. At the heart of the trail is the Bear Creek
Loop which is 2.6 miles of single track (take this up) and 4.2 miles
of double track (a very fast downhill). The trail itself as drawn
on the map is approximately 23 miles. Below in the Trail Markers
section is the route to make up the 23 miles. As drawn this trail
has a 4 mile climb on a forest service gravel road. This 4 miles
ends at the upper trail parking and is the toughest part of the
workout. Once you reach the bottom of the loop, lower trail parking,
you are faced with another 4.4 mile climb on single and double track
that is a bit easier. Finally, back at the upper trail parking you
get the same 4 mile F/S road but this time you're going straight
down. Your speed can easily reach 30 mph so be careful and pay attention.
This is definitely an intermediate trail.

| Directions Ellijay |
The Bear Creek Trail is located about 13 miles
N. W. of Ellijay, GA. The most direct way from Atlanta is take GA
400 (US 19) to GA 52. Make a left onto GA 52 and go to the town of
Ellijay. In Ellijay continue on GA 52 for approximately 8 miles. At
the 8 mile "marker" make a right onto Gates Chapel Rd. Go
approximately 5 miles to F/S road 241. Make a right onto F/S 241 which
will take you to the camping area (1 mile) then lower bike parking
(another mile). You will see many people who are not camping park
on Gates Chapel Road at the 5 mile point. Don't do that, park in the
designated parking area.

| Activities: |
Hiking, Mountain Biking, Camping:
There is remote camping right off the trail on F/S road 241. It is
first come first serve so on the weekends I would suggest you get
there early.
